Master Clarence Smith, Jr.
Seventh Degree Black Belt
• Senior Instructor
Master "Smittie" (as he
is known to the Kim Studio family) has been training in the martial arts
for more than 25 years and is familiar with many different styles. He had
the honor to train with Grandmaster Ki Whang Kim for about 15 years before
being promoted to 6th dan in 1993. He also holds first, second and third
place winnings in heavyweight fighting and forms competitions. Martial
arts is Master Smith's way of life; he will continue to pursue it while
helping to maintain the Kim Studio art. Master Smith teaches in Rockville every
Saturday at 1:00 p.m.
Master Jason Hill
Seventh Degree Black Belt
• Senior Instructor
Master Jason Hill has trained in the martial
arts for more than 26 years and has been instructing at Kim Studio since
1991. His training began in 1977
at age seven and has continued ever since. He has competed in many competitions
along the East Coast and, in February 2004, successfully tested for the
7th dan master rank. He plans to continue teaching in order to pass along
the knowledge of the late Grandmaster Kim. Master Hill teaches adult
mixed belts in Rockville on Wednesdays at 6 p.m. He also teaches at the
Laurel Studio on Fridays at 6 p.m. and on Saturdays
at 11:30 a.m.

Mr. Hank Nicodemus
Fourth Degree Black Belt
• Instructor
Hank Nicodemus first began training at Kim
Studio in 1986 at the age of 14. In his beginners class, he emphasizes
basic techniques as well as forms work and earned the Instructor of the
Year Award in 1999. He was promoted to fourth dan in February 2004. In
addition to his martial arts training at Kim Studio, Hank also studies
the Filipino styles of Arnis and Escrima. Hank teaches adult mixed
belts at 6 p.m. and weapons at 7:30 at the Rockville dojo on Mondays.
